1

Hiring a trusted roofing contractor ensures high-quality service and reliable roofing solutions.

News Discuss 
Factors You Need To Require Professional Roof Solutions for Your Next Job When taking on a roof task, the decision to work with professional roof covering services is not just an option, however a necessity. Why not check out the manifold advantages of employing specialist roofing solutions for your following https://louisyeggg.loginblogin.com/41410306/experienced-roofers-in-roswell-ga-can-handle-everything-from-minor-fixes-to-complete-roof-replacements

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story